#3bf157 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3bf157 is composed of 23.1% red, 94.5% green and 34.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 63.9%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 129.2 degrees, a saturation of 86.7% and a lightness of 58.8%. #3bf157 color hex could be obtained by blending #76ffae with #00e300. Closest websafe color is: #33ff66.

#3bf157 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3bf157 has RGB values of R:59, G:241, B:87 and CMYK values of C:0.76, M:0, Y:0.64,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 3928407.
